C++編で扱っている C++ は 2003年に登場した C++03 という、とても古いバージョンのものです。C++ はその後、C++11 -> C++14 -> C++17 -> C++20 -> C++23 と更新されています。 なかでも C++11 での更新は非常に大きなものであり、これから C++ の学習を始めるのなら、C++11 よりも古いバージョンを対象にするべきではありません。特に事情がないなら、新しい C++ を学んでください。 当サイトでは、C++14 をベースにした新C++編を作成中です。 これまでの章では、1つのクラスから継承を行って、派生クラスを定義していましたが、2つ以上のクラスから継承することも可能です。このような、複数のクラスから継承を行うことを、多重継承と呼びます。また、1つのクラスからの継承を、多重継承と対比させて、単一継承と呼びます。 多重継承を行うと、複
!['多重継承 | Programming Place Plus C++編【言語解説】 第30章'](https://cdn-ak-scissors.b.st-hatena.com/image/square/8cdb55dd18a58b6cc907e46c040c0ee1e16643cf/height=288;version=1;width=512/https%3A%2F%2Fprogramming-place.net%2FOGP%2Fcontents%2Fcpp%2Flanguage%2F030.png)